
IONSCAN 600
Portable desktop trace detector that identifies explosives and narcotics — including fentanyl — in under eight seconds.
The IONSCAN 600 is a benchtop ion mobility spectrometry (IMS) trace detection system used to screen swab samples from surfaces, baggage exteriors, and personnel for trace quantities of explosive residues and narcotics. The technology ionises sample particles and measures the time they take to drift through a controlled electric field; different compounds produce characteristic drift-time signatures that the algorithm compares against a library of threats.
The system detects a wide library of military, commercial, and improvised explosives — including RDX, TNT, PETN, and TATP precursors — alongside narcotics including cocaine, amphetamine, methamphetamine, and fentanyl, including potent synthetic fentanyl opioids that are a growing concern at international airports. Detection and identification complete in under eight seconds from swab insertion, with warm-up from cold taking under ten minutes.
A distinctive feature is the non-radioactive IMS source, which eliminates the national nuclear regulatory licensing requirements that constrain deployment of radioactive-source trace detectors in many jurisdictions — particularly relevant for GCC airports where import and operating licences for radioactive equipment add cost and compliance burden. The 9-inch colour touchscreen with anti-reflective glass is designed for sustained operational use in bright or outdoor-adjacent environments.
In aviation, the IONSCAN 600 is used at hold baggage secondary screening positions, VIP and aircrew access controls, cargo acceptance sampling, and checkpoint secondary resolution stations. It holds TSA ACSTL approval as the first approved explosives trace detector on the air cargo screening technology list.
Technical specifications.
| Detection time | < 8 seconds |
| Warm-up time | < 10 minutes |
| Weight (without printer) | 23.8 lbs (10.8 kg) |
| Display | 9" colour touchscreen, anti-reflective |
| Battery backup | 1 hour, hot-swappable |
| Operating temperature | -10 to +50 °C |
| Altitude | Up to 10,000 ft |
| IMS source | Non-radioactive (no nuclear licence required) |
| Certifications | TSA ACSTL (explosives trace detector), ECAC/EU, CAAC |
